Saldus Parish

Saldus Parish (Latvian: Saldus pagasts) is an administrative unit of Saldus Municipality, Latvia. It borders the town of Saldus and its administrative center, Druva.

Historically, the area was a part of the land of Kumbri Manor (German: Gut Kumbern), the center of which was located in modern-day Druva.

The parish is the birthplace of 19th century Latvian painter Janis Rozentāls.
